Logistics and warehousing equipment can be divided into packaging equipment, warehousing equipment, container unit equipment, loading and unloading equipment, circulation processing equipment, and transportation equipment according to their specific uses.
1. Packaging equipment
Packaging equipment refers to machines and devices that complete all or part of the packaging process. Packaging equipment is the fundamental guarantee for achieving mechanization and automation in product packaging. Mainly including filling equipment, canning equipment, sealing equipment, wrapping equipment, labeling equipment, cleaning equipment, drying equipment, sterilization equipment, etc.
2. Storage equipment
It mainly includes shelves, stacker trucks, handling vehicles, entry and exit conveyor equipment, sorting equipment, elevators, handling robots, as well as computer management and monitoring systems. These devices can form automated, semi automated, and mechanized commercial warehouses for stacking, storing, and sorting and transporting goods.
3. Container unit equipment
There are mainly containers, pallets, turnover boxes, and other container unit equipment. After being containerized or packaged in combination by container equipment, the goods have high flexibility and are always ready for operation, which is conducive to achieving the integration of storage, loading and unloading, transportation and packaging, and achieving the mechanization and standardization of logistics operations.
4. Loading and unloading equipment
It refers to equipment used for moving, lifting, loading and unloading, and short distance transportation of materials, and is an important component of logistics machinery and equipment. From the perspective of usage and structural characteristics, loading and unloading equipment mainly includes lifting equipment, continuous transportation equipment, loading and unloading vehicles, specialized loading and unloading equipment, etc.
5. Circulation processing equipment
Mainly including metal processing equipment, mixing and blending equipment, wood processing equipment, and other circulation processing equipment.
6. Transportation equipment

The unique position of transportation in logistics has raised higher requirements for transportation equipment, requiring it to have high-speed, intelligent, universal, large-scale, and safe and reliable characteristics to improve transportation efficiency, reduce transportation costs, and achieve optimal utilization of transportation equipment. According to different modes of transportation, transportation equipment can be divided into cargo trucks, railway freight cars, cargo ships, air transport equipment, and pipeline equipment. For third-party logistics companies, they generally only have a certain number of cargo trucks, while other transportation equipment directly utilizes public transportation equipment in society.
